Hancheng City, which lies in the northeast of Shaanxi Province, is one of the most famous cities for its history and culture in China. And the architectural frescoes during the Ming and Qing Dynasty in the city are really rare gems of this ancient city. The frescoes are obviously marked by the characteristics of the Chinese mainstream paintings. This essay provides the characteristics of the Chinese mainstream paintings through frescoes during the Ming and Qing Dynasty, and expounds the geographical environment, the main characteristics of the frescoes, the achievements in art, and how to adopt measures to protect the frescoes in the future as well. The writer intends to make people concerned understand the frescoes better. In this way, they can keep on studying the frescoes to discover the great art value of further study. Meanwhile, it's helpful to arouse people to realize the importance to protect the frescoes. So they may pay great attention to protecting the frescoes.
